GPIO solution of IR sending and learning based on ESP8266

1. Application scenarios of solution
When developers want to add IR sending & learning functions in the products made of Wi-Fi module ESP8266, they only need to load the lib file developed by ZaZaRemote to the modules to realize it. They do not need to use any additional IR remote control chip.
Solution value: spare development time, save a remote control chip and its assembling cost, simplify PCB assay and reduce defect rate.
Special value: The solution is connected to the IR code library of ZaZaRemote, the best one in the world. Huawei, TCL, Lenovo and Philips are all using the code library of ZaZaRemote. Containing 30, 0000 different kinds of remote controls, it has been applied globally with 62 million customers are using it. The code library is still keep growing and maintained by ZaZaRemote continually.
